About Tooth and Tail

Tooth and Tail is an Arcade-Style Real-Time Strategy game set in a world of animal revolution. Wage war with customizable factions, featuring units like mustard-gas skunks and flamethrowing boars. From Pocketwatch Games, the creators of the IGF-winning game Monaco. Tooth and Tail distills the Real Time Strategy genre down to a few buttons and eight-minute matches.[1]

Production on Tooth and Tail began in Spring of 2014.
